Expense can be a substantial aspect when thinking about private psychiatric services. The charges for a private psychiatrist can vary based on experience, location, and type of consultation. Below is a typical breakdown:
Type of ServiceApproximated CostPreliminary Consultation₤ 200 - ₤ 400Follow-Up Appointments₤ 100 - ₤ 300Treatment Sessions₤ 75 - ₤ 200Medication ManagementIncluded in follow-upsAdditional ServicesDiffers by supplierFAQs About Private Psychiatry in the UKQ1: How do I find a private psychiatrist?
Individuals can find a private psychiatrist through referrals from family doctors, online directory sites, or mental health companies. It is also recommended to check credentials and areas of specialty before picking a psychiatrist.
Q2: Will my insurance coverage cover private psychiatric services?
Lots of private medical insurance prepares cover psychiatry, however it's important to verify the specifics with your insurance provider. Pre-authorization might be required.
Q3: Is private psychiatric care much better than NHS care?
Each has its strengths and weak points. Private psychiatry uses quicker access and customized services, while NHS care is normally more economical and available to all.
